I've used both Xiaomi 2 and Xiaomi 3. Fantastic deal if you can get it directly from their website, but ordering it online at another store is usually only 100 to 200 kuai more.
Unfortunately it only has English and Chinese. The English isn't too bad, although a bit technical at times.
The only thing I don't like is that from the original to the 3rd they seem to come with more and more junk software preinstalled. Fortunately most of it can be deleted.
By default it doesn't come with the Google Play store either. I've installed it on Xiaomi 2, but never tried to install it on the Xiaomi 3.
Xiaomi also provides a place to download other roms. Though I don't think the stock android ROM has been updated lately, and not sure what languages it comes with... But here is the site if you want to try yourself: rom.xiaomi.cn/

Try changing the encryption settings in your torrent software. Usually there are three: required, try/attempt, and none.
Sometimes you have to wait 15 or more minutes to get fast speeds. Generally the first few attempts at connecting will be blocked.
I use ExpressVPN, but usually don't require it for torrents. Sometimes for less popular torrents, such as Linux distros in beta, I will connect to VPN for five minutes and then disconnect the VPN.
As for VPN connection issues, I find rotating between four or five countries works best. I try not to connect to the same country more than once within one day.
